Output e7ec85cdc4232b3fd5955d747a2a48e9dcffd817aedefeb74f1253db0c989f7c:1

value
1489681
script pubkey
OP_0 OP_PUSHBYTES_20 2eb66d3605bc53e509bca67455821953d7c62a8a
address
bc1q96mx6ds9h3f72zdu5e69tqse20tuv252twh840
transaction
e7ec85cdc4232b3fd5955d747a2a48e9dcffd817aedefeb74f1253db0c989f7c
confirmations
152803
spent
true